在HTML5中,如果你想在文本中插入一个简单的换行符,你可以直接使用 <br>
标签。这个标签告诉浏览器在此处结束当前行并开始新的一行。这是一个示例:
<p>这是第一行文本。<br>这是第二行文本。</p>
在这个例子中,<br>
后面的文字会紧接着出现在新的一行。请注意,尽管 <br>
可以实现换行效果,但推荐使用 <p>
标签来表示段落,因为它具有更好的语义性。
- br 可插入一个简单的换行符。
- br标签是空标签(意味着它没有结束标签,因此这是错误的:br /br)。
- 在 XHTML 中,把结束标签放在开始标签中,也就是 br /。
- 请注意,br标签只是简单地开始新的一行,而当浏览器遇到 p标签时,通常会在相邻的段落之间插入一些垂直的间距。
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>java</title>
</head>
<body>
java program!<br> author: programb
</body>
</html>
除了<br>
(用于插入换行),HTML中还有多种标签可用于控制文本布局,包括:
-
<h1>
到<h6>
:这些是标题标签,用于定义不同级别的标题,从一级(最重要)到六级。 -
<p>
:代表段落,用于分隔并组织正文的不同部分。 -
<span>
:行内元素,可应用于已存在行内内容的部分,以便设置特定区域的样式或进行JavaScript操作。 -
<div>
:虽然不是文本布局直接相关的,但常常用于划分页面结构,可以包含其他标签形成自定义容器,方便样式管理和内容组织。 -
<hr>
:水平线,用于创建页面中断点或分割区域。 -
<ul>
和<ol>
:无序列表和有序列表,用于列举项目。 -
<li>
:列表项,属于上述列表标签下的子元素。 -
<pre>
和<code>
:预格式化文本,保持原始格式显示代码或格式化的文本。 -
<blockquote>
:引用块,用于标记引用的内容。 -
<strong>
和<em>
:强调文本,前者表示重要,后者表示斜体。
在实际应用中,选择哪个标签取决于文本的具体需求,如标题层次、段落划分、列表展示等。示例:
<h1>这是大标题</h1>
<p>这是第一个段落。</p>
<ul>
<li>列表项一</li>
<li>列表项二</li>
</ul>
<div class="my-section">
这里是一段带样式的文本<span style="color:red;">红字部分</span>
</div>
<hr />